Why does my pet need routine grooming?

Routine grooming of your pet not only keeps your dog’s hair looking great, but it also helps preserve your dog’s fur and physical health and wellbeing. When your pet gets groomed, it helps it avoid painful matting and knots in their fur, eliminates the build-up of bacteria and hot-spots (dermatitis), and keeps thedog clear from pests like ticks. Within your pet’s grooming appointment, your Vernon dog groomer will look out for bumps and sores that could relate to a health issue.


How often should your pet get groomed?

Grooming requirements for your dog will vary depending on the breed, hair and your dog’s habits. Some dogs only need sporadic bath, brush and nail trim whilst other dog breeds may need more frequent grooming sessions. As a general rule, most pet owners schedule frequent grooming about once a month. For pups and dogs who have not been groomed yet, more regular burshing at home should be performed to get them used to being handled and to prevent grooming issues as they grow up. What’s the difference between a dog bathing and grooming service?

Pet bathing services consist of: 1-3 rounds of shampoo, 1 round of conditioner, hand-dry as allowed by pet, brushing and/or combing.

Dog grooming consist of: Everything included from bathing plus a full cut/style based on breed standards and/or your specific requests, nails trimmed, and ears cleaned.

Can I stay with my pet whilst it is getting groomed?

For a better experience for your dog and for their safety it is important that the dog groomer has their complete attention. Most pets are distracted by their owners attendance and will behave so much better without their owners being present. Discuss any fears you have with the dog groomer in Vernon VT when you bring your dog in, and then swiftly and fuss-free hand over your pet to them. If you extend the procedure, your dog will pick up on your stress and become more worried as well.

Do Vernon groomers offer pets sedatives?

Dog grooming salons in Vernon Vermont cannot lawfully sedate a canine. If the groomer works in a veterinary health center the vet can authorize sedation however it is given by a technician. In the case of oral medications that a vet has actually recommended, an owner can give it to the pet prior to a grooming visit, as it takes about an hour to be reliable.

What’s hand stripping for dogs?

Hand stripping is a dog grooming process that includes removing dead hairs from the coat by hand instead of clipping to keep the coat tidy and healthy. Generally completed two times a year in spring and autumn, it speeds up the natural process of growth and shedding.

Can you trim a double coated canine?

You can still trim a lot of the coat off but not shave so close as to shave undercoat. Get rid of as much of the undercoat as possible prior to trimming the external coat. This may permit you to select a bit much shorter guard comb alternative. Don’t just rake the jacket or back of the pet.

How frequently should you bathe a double coated dog?

Generally, every 2 to 12 weeks. In general, you ought to shower a double coated pet every 2 to twelve weeks, depending on your dog’s tolerance for grooming and skin condition along with the season.
